Safety experts say it’s important not only for drivers to know the Highway Traffic Act but pedestrians as well.
The big yellow machines are back on the roads for the first time in six months and kids and parents are walking to and from school.
Jim Brazil of Safety NL says it’s important that drivers and pedestrians be engaged in the task at hand and not be paying attention to other things such as cell phones.
He says people should walk facing traffic with no more than two abreast.
He says if you have three or four buddies walking side-by-side, you’re going to end up with one or two of them on the pavement and in traffic.
